O microfone não está funcionando no Ubuntu 16.04

14

Estou com um problema com meu áudio HDA ​​Intel PCH no Ubuntu 16.04. Nunca tive problemas com os alto-falantes, no entanto, meu microfone não está funcionando.

Quando conecto o microfone na entrada, o sistema reage e parece que o microfone está inserido; no entanto, nenhuma barra aparece em nenhuma configuração em "Níveis de entrada". O microfone funciona bem, apenas testado no notebook com o Ubuntu 12.04.

Captura de tela

Aqui está a minha informação

Jakub Cerny
fonte
Você resolveu o seu problema ?? Estou tendo o mesmo problema!
11117 lotfio

Respostas:

11

Eu tive esse problema exato. Minha solução:

1) abra o controle PulseAudio

2) vá para a guia de configuração.

3) selecione duplex estéreo analógico para usar os computadores embutidos em áudio e microfone

insira a descrição da imagem aqui

SmellyFishMan
fonte
Descobri que, embora minha configuração fosse Analog Stereo Duplex, alternar para outra configuração e voltar ao duplex resolve o problema.
MHT
de qualquer maneira para mudar para microfone automaticamente? Este obras, mas parece que temos de mudar a cada vez manualmente saída
Breno Salgado
Isso não foi corrigido para mim
HackerBoss 15/02
4

Talvez isso funcione. Por favor, responda para ver se isso é específico para esse laptop ou não.

/ubuntu//a/824806/47206

/unix//a/358989/32012

sudo apt-get install alsa-tools-gui

Então inicie

hdajackretask

Então:

Marque 'Mostrar pinos não conectados'

Verifique o pino de substituição 0x12 no microfone interno.

Aplique e teste. Verifique se o nível do microfone está alto o suficiente nas configurações de som (controle de pavimento, etc.)

Se funcionou 'Instalar substituição de inicialização'.

insira a descrição da imagem aqui


fonte
estou tendo o mesmo problema e isso respondeu não resolvê-lo? quaisquer outras soluções
lotfio
@ForDev - qual laptop você tem? Você vê o seu microfone em configurações de áudio ou pavucontrolsob Dispositivos de Entrada guia? Caso contrário, na guia Configuração : verifique se selecionou '' Duplex estéreo analógico ".
thnx para a repetição eu tenho apenas mudou para debian e tudo está funcionando bem thnx :) i tentar todas as soluções, mas não funcionou para mim eu acho que o mybe problema vem das atualizações porque antes de tudo estava funcionando bem
lotfio
@ForDev - você quer dizer que isso foi corrigido com o lançamento do Debian? Qual versão do kernel, por favor? Talvez eu vá tropeçar nisso no futuro no Asus e usar um kernel mais recente pode ser o caminho a percorrer.
Quando tento aplicar as alterações eu recebo este erro: pa_stream_writablee_size () falhou: Conexão terminada
hellocatfood
3

Meu problema foi uma pequena variação do problema do OP - eu tenho um conector de fone de ouvido (fones de ouvido estéreo e microfone combinados).

Primeiro use o hdajackretask, verifique se o problema não está relacionado ao conector (por exemplo, consulte a solução do user47206 ). Para mim, minha tomada foi corretamente detectada como 'Headphone'.

  1. Pressione Ctrl+ Alt+ tpara acessar o terminal.
  2. Digite cat /proc/asound/card*/codec* | grep Codeco terminal e anote os codecs listados.
  3. Se houver vários codecs listados, determine qual deles está relacionado ao conector do fone de ouvido. Para mim, havia dois listados - um relacionado à placa de vídeo ( Codec: ATI R6xx HDMI) e outro relacionado à placa de som ( Codec: Realtek ALC3861). No meu caso, eu estava interessado na placa de som porque estava conectando à tomada do fone de ouvido do PC e não a um dispositivo HDMI, como um monitor de PC.
  4. Procure o modelo de áudio HD para o seu codec em modelos específicos de codec de áudio HD . Para o meu fone de ouvido, o melhor ajuste foi o modelo dell-headset-multi .
  5. Digite cd /etc/modprobe.d/o terminal.
  6. Digite sudo cp alsa-base.conf alsa-base.conf.bakpara fazer backup do arquivo antes de editar.
  7. Digite gksudo gedit ./alsa-base.confpara editar o arquivo.
  8. Insira esta linha na parte inferior do arquivo options snd-hda-intel model={HD-Audio model for you codec}. Por exemplo, para mim era options snd-hda-intel model=dell-headset-multi.
  9. Salve o arquivo e reinicie.
JayDin
fonte
Obrigado, isso funcionou para mim (modelo aspire-headset-mic).
Razem 13/07/19
1

Eu tive um problema semelhante e tentei todas as respostas que encontrei on-line sem sorte. Finalmente, do alsamixer, mudei a opção Channel, que era de 6 canais, para 4 canais ou 2 canais, e o microfone começou a capturar entradas, não sei por que ...

Pizzicato
fonte
1

Solução muito fácil.

Captura de tela

tl; dr: pressione o ícone vermelho de volume, como mostrado na imagem da captura de tela acima.

Eu tive o mesmo problema. No Ubuntu 16.04.3 LTS, KDE

Minha solução:

1) Vá para "Configurações de volume de áudio"

2) Selecione "Dispositivos de entrada" (guia)

** no canto superior direito, o ícone de som é marcado em vermelho. Como mudo.

3) Pressione (clique esquerdo) o ícone de som vermelho (mencionado acima)

4) Pressione OK

Verifique se o problema está resolvido.

Caso contrário, escolha a opção correta nas opções de porta na guia Dispositivos de entrada (eu escolho o microfone interno) e verifique se a porcentagem de volume está acima de 0%, de preferência para o teste definido como 100%.

Era o microfone interno no meu laptop. Ou seja, o microfone embutido no meu laptop.

gy
fonte
1

Eu fiz isso pessoal!

  1. sudo gedit /etc/modprobe.d/alsa-base.conf
  2. Procure options snd-usb-audio index=-2e mude para options snd-usb-audio index=0
  3. Adicionar options snd-hda-intel model=auto
Mokka Mokka
fonte
infelizmente isso não funcionou no ubuntu 19.1 + acer swift 3 :( parece que essa foi minha última opção.
FlyingZebra1